The silk is harvested from the cocoons spun by the silkworms when they are ready to pupate. The cocoons are boiled, and the silk threads used to make the cocoon are unwound and used to make the silk as we knot it. In the Torah, a scarlet cloth item called in Hebrew “sheni tola’at” שני תולעת – literally “crimson of the worm” – is described as being used in purification ceremonies, such as those following a leprosy outbreak (Leviticus 14), alongside cedar wood and hyssop (za’atar). Eminent scholar and leading medieval translator of Jewish sources and books of the Bible into Arabic, Rabbi Saadia Gaon, translates this phrase explicitly as “crimson silk” – חריר קרמז حرير قرمز. Biocompatibility, i.e., to what level the silk will cause an immune response, is a critical issue for biomaterials. Wax or silicone is usually used as a coating to avoid fraying and potential immune responses[78] when silk fibers serve as suture materials. Although the lack of detailed characterization of silk fibers, such as the extent of the removal of sericin, the surface chemical properties of coating material, and the process used, make it difficult to determine the real immune response of silk fibers in literature, it is generally believed that sericin is the major cause of immune response. Thus, the removal of sericin is an essential step to assure biocompatibility in biomaterial applications of silk.

In Terengganu, which is now part of Malaysia, a second generation of silkworm was being imported as early as 1764 for the country’s silk textile industry, especially songket.[58] However, since the 1980s, Malaysia is no longer engaged in sericulture but does plant mulberry trees. World War II interrupted the silk trade from Asia, and silk prices increased dramatically.[57] U.S. industry began to look for substitutes, which led to the use of synthetics such as nylon.
